NNSA said Tuesday Triad National Security will extend the work it performs at the federally funded research and development center from November 1, 2023, through October 30, 2028.
Triad, a limited liability firm, won the potential 10-year, $25 billion contract in June 2018 for LANL operations and management services.
The agency factored in contractor performance and current price in making the decision to exercise option periods one through five on the original award.
LANL conducts research in the areas of nuclear security, intelligence, defense, emergency response, nonproliferation, counterterrorism, energy security, emerging threats and environmental management.
